  6. Our Mission. UMBC is a dynamic public research university integrating teaching, research and service to benefit the citizens of Maryland. As an Honors University, the campus offers academically talented students a strong undergraduate liberal arts foundation that prepares them for graduate and professional study, entry into the workforce, and community service and leadership.

  7. UMBC allows undergrads to transfer credits for coursework, competency-based education, and military training. Up to 90 credits can be applied towards the degree. Transferring Coursework to UMBC. UMBC participates in the Academic Common Market (ACM). You may qualify to study in a specialized field at a reduced tuition rate.
